"The Dyson V11 generates 185 Air Watts of suction through its Dyson Hyperdymium motor which spins at 125,000 rpm to create cyclonic forces that capture 99.97% of particles down to 0.3 microns. That microscopic filtration traps allergens, dust mites and pet dander instead of blowing them back into your air like cheap vacuums with inadequate sealing. The fully sealed filtration system ensures what gets sucked in stays trapped in the bin rather than escaping through gaps and vents."

Three cleaning modes — Eco, Auto and Boost — adjust power for battery conservation or maximum extraction. The torque drive head and Dynamic Load Sensor extract embedded debris, while a seven-cell lithium-ion battery provides up to 60 minutes of fade-free runtime.
